Just bought this 2000 Taurus and found out that AC blows ambient air, not cold air. Had mechanic dye check for leak and found none. Checked fuse and it is good. When turn temp control to AC, I do not hear or feel any engagement of the AC (I can feel my other car engine load increase when AC is turned on).  Any idea what is wrong?
Answer -
Could be any number of sensors that have a fault. Could be a wiring problem in any one or more of the A/C electrical system. Could be a fault in the CONTROL PANEL or the heater-A/C control unit.

Are you ABSOLUTELY POSITIVE that you have enough freon in the A/C system ?.


This is going to require extensive testing.

IF the system is FULL of freon, I would suspect that the LOW PRESSURE sensor is faulty of which will NOT let the compressor engage.

I have also seen the POWER STEERING PRESSURE SWITCH fail of which will also cause the compressor NOT to engage.
